[QUOTE="keep_hope_alive, post: 8357092, member: 576029"] hi there. you shouldn't feel like you're going to be flamed for asking questions. we've all started somewhere, and it was modest when we paid for it ourselves. Class AB amps will run hot. Best to use that amp on speakers and get a monoblock amp. A Massive Audio N2 would be a nice amp for that sub. Having more power than you need is preferred so the amp isn't running at max output all of the time.
